Go语言因其简洁的语法和高效的性能,成为开发跨平台应用的优选语言。在Windows服务器上,使用Go编写脚本可以实现自动化任务、系统监控或服务部署等操作。

安装Go语言环境是开发的第一步。访问Go官网下载适合Windows的安装包,按照提示完成安装后,配置好GOPATH和GOROOT环境变量,确保命令行中能正确调用go命令。

AI绘图结果,仅供参考

编写脚本时,建议使用标准库中的os、fmt、time等模块处理文件、输入输出和时间相关功能。对于需要与操作系统交互的任务,可调用exec包执行外部命令,或通过os/exec实现进程管理。

Windows特有的功能如注册表操作、服务管理等,可通过调用Windows API实现。Go语言支持通过cgo调用C代码,结合Windows SDK可以更灵活地操作系统资源。

脚本完成后,使用go build命令生成可执行文件,确保其在目标Windows服务器上运行无依赖问题。测试时应覆盖不同场景,确保脚本稳定可靠。

部署脚本时,可将其加入计划任务(Task Scheduler)或作为后台服务运行,提升自动化程度。同时,注意日志记录和错误处理,便于后续维护和问题排查。

dawei

【声明】:安庆站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。